Coidzor
2013-05-22, 01:52 PM
How would this work mechanical? Does the wild-shaped druid still benefit from my Mounted Combat feat? Do we act as one entity, or do we still have separate action slot in a round, ie: Flying Druid casts spells, and the Cavalier rain arrow death from his back.

Mounted combat (http://www.d20pfsrd.com/feats/combat-feats/mounted-combat-combat---final) feat would apply, yes as your character is mounted upon the cohort.

They act as two separate entities because they're two separate characters with their own sets of actions. Usually best for one to hold until the other's initiative count so that they can better coordinate. The druid can fly around and cast spells and the cavalier can rain down arrows, yeah, but it seems a waste to use cavalier in this instance, since they're not exactly the best archers by my understanding and you seem to be wasting the mount entirely by using a cohort instead.

Even if you didn't use the cohort as a mount having a druid in the party could be a big benefit. Druid can use call animal (with some +CL traits/effects) and wartrain mount to capture and temp train almost any animal mount you could want at any time. Cavalier can quickly train them to prevent the spell from needing to be cast every day. Have your goblin with his small lance initiate charges on the back of a Roc etc. Basically any animal in the book can be yours as a mount within a few hours and replacing a dead one is trivial. Between the two of you you could easily have a trained zoo of animals all with the "defend" command given for the low low price of 0 gold.

Also nothing stopping you from using the druid's animal companion as a backup mount either.
